Biographical history

John Henry Shaw was born in August of 1867, to parents Daniel and Jane, at Westmeath in Renfrew County, Ontario. He became licensed as an Ontario Land Surveyor and in 1900 he married Elizabeth Ann in Carleton County, Ontario. Throughout his career he worked for the provincial government surveying townships in Ontario and CNR lines.He died on May 12, 1922, at North Bay, Ontario, due to a case of chronic nephritis.

Scope and content

A certified reproduction of the "Subdivision of Park Lot # 16, Reg. Plan 232, being part of Lot # 1 A, Concession 1, Township of Murray, now Trenton.” The area surveyed includes; Park Lot # 16, both sides of Edward Street and west of Sidney Street. Surveyed by John H. Shaw, O. L. S. and signed July 24, 1917.

This copy was made in 1972 of plan #490, as registered in the Hastings Land Registry Office.

Donated by Walter I. Watson, P. L. S.
